While preparing our tax year 2005 returns, I realized that I had made an error with our Tax year 2004 tax submissions . The error, not properly recognizing a rental property as actively managed (versus passive) seemingly will result in an ~$500 refund from the feds. I used Tax Cut to prepare out returns. It was fairly straight forward to prepare a federal 1040-X. Unfortunately the Tax Cut CT state program does not seem to support an amended return. Further the CT refund would be quite small, an amount I would gladly ignore do to the "hassle factor'! My question: Is there any problem if I amend our Federal return, but not the CT?

I'm surprised TaxCut doesn't support the CT 1040X. I'm sure TurboTax does. You may technically be required to report any federal tax change to Connecticut. However, no one will penalize you for allowing the state to keep your money . If it isn't worth your time and effort to amend the return, don't bother. Katie in San Diego
